The Allure of Optimization: How Speed and Efficiency Boost Your Edge

First, let's talk about the good stuff. When you optimize your crypto trading infrastructure, you're essentially upgrading your toolkit to compete with the big players. One of the biggest pros is reduced latency—the time it takes for your order to reach the exchange's matching engine. If you set up a dedicated server near a major exchange's data center, for example, your latency might drop from 20 milliseconds to under one millisecond. That's a massive edge in volatile markets where prices shift in seconds.

Another benefit is better risk management through automation. Optimized infrastructure allows you to implement stop-losses, trailing orders, and dynamic position sizing without manual oversight. You can set your system to react to market conditions 24/7, which is priceless if you can't watch charts all day. Also, modern infrastructure can handle higher workloads, meaning you can process more data streams—like order book depth and news sentiment—without your software slowing down. For highly active traders, this efficiency pays off by reducing errors and missed opportunities.

However, it's important to note that not all optimization is equally beneficial. For retail traders with smaller portfolios, spending thousands on custom hardware may generate diminishing returns. That's where you need to weigh costs against potential gains. But if you're committed to high-frequency or algorithmic trading, the pros can far outweigh the cons.

The Hidden Costs and Risks You Shouldn't Ignore

Now, the flip side. Optimization isn't a magic fix—it comes with very real downside. One of the most overlooked cons is the risk of system fragility. When you streamline your infrastructure—for example, by using multiple servers or custom scripts—you create additional points of failure. A single misconfiguration in your API call, for instance, could send bad orders to the exchange, leading to unexpected losses. This becomes especially dangerous during high volatility, when your system is under maximum stress.

Another specific challenge relates to security trade-offs. For instance, some optimization techniques involve storing API keys locally in configuration files, which exposes them to malware or data breaches.
